The Enduring Appeal of Life in a... Metro

Life in a... Metro wasn't just another Bollywood movie; it was a cinematic experience. The film's success lay in its relatable characters and the realistic portrayal of urban life. Director Anurag Basu masterfully crafted a narrative that interwove several stories, each offering a unique perspective on love, relationships, and the challenges of modern living. The movie managed to capture the essence of Mumbai – its energy, its chaos, and its ability to bring people together. The movie's soundtrack, with its soulful melodies and catchy tunes, further enhanced the viewing experience, making the film a memorable one for audiences. The movie's success also highlighted the power of ensemble casts, where each actor brought depth and nuance to their roles, making the characters believable and engaging. The film's popularity also transcended regional boundaries, appealing to audiences across India and beyond. This success demonstrated the film's universal themes of love, loss, and the human condition, which resonated with viewers from diverse backgrounds.

Casting Ideas and Expectations

Casting is a critical aspect of a sequel. The original cast was a major reason behind the success of Life in a... Metro, and bringing back the original actors would be a huge draw for the sequel. Actors like Konkona Sen Sharma, Irrfan Khan (may his soul rest in peace), and Sharman Joshi were key to the original movie. Getting these actors back for a sequel would be a great move. This could include the reunion of iconic characters with new plotlines. It would be amazing to see the dynamics between the characters and how their relationships have evolved over time.
